1. Subject authority files, receiving message that subject 'does not exist in authority file and click submit to force the subject' ??!!
The way that the authority file works at the moment is best explained by thinking of it as a virtual authority file. If you try to add a subject that doesnt currently exist, it will squeal. This is just a simple check to hopefully catch typo's etc. Work is being down to formalise the authority files and build in the concepts of SEE Instead, etc.
